What Happened
Blackstone's Offer for Sale (OFS) of Knowledge Realty Trust units was subscribed 1.4 times on Day 1, driven by strong demand from non-retail investors. This OFS, valued at ₹11,988 crore, is the largest in India's private sector, showcasing significant institutional interest in the country's commercial real estate market.
Why It Matters (for you)
The robust subscription signals strong investor confidence in India's Real Estate Investment Trust (REIT) market and the underlying commercial real estate sector. It indicates ample liquidity and a willingness among large investors to deploy capital into income-generating assets, which is a positive sign for future REIT listings and existing players.
Impact on Indian Markets
This development is positive for listed Indian REITs such as Embassy Office Parks REIT (EMBASSY), Mindspace Business Parks REIT (MINDSPACE), and Brookfield India Real Estate Trust (BROOKFILD). The strong demand for a peer's offering suggests a healthy appetite for similar assets, potentially leading to re-rating or sustained interest in these stocks.
